Mission
Many of us grapple with mental health issues, such as addiction, depression, and anxiety, often suffering in silence. The reclaimed foundation's purpose is to offer support to our community and create a welcoming environment that embraces these challenges. Through connection, honesty, and vulnerability, we aim to help each other heal.
